Strong's Exhausive Concised Dictionary - תָּבוּן
תָּבוּן
H8394
Transliteration: tâbûwn
Pronunciation: taw-boon'
Definition: discretion
תָּבוּן (tâbûwn | taw-boon')
[Heb] תָּבוּן, תְּבוּנָה, תּוּבְנָה OSHL: b.bo.ah TWOT: 239c GK: H9312" class="dictionary-topic-link">H9312, H9341" class="dictionary-topic-link">H9341 Greek:λόγος , φρόνησις , φρόνιμος
Derivation: and (feminine) תְּבוּנָה; or תֹּובֻנָה; from בִּין;
Strong's: intelligence; by implication, an argument; by extension, caprice
KJV: discretion, reason, skilfulness, understanding, wisdom.
